Abstract: The invention features methods of obtaining high-yield, essentially pure human predipocyte cultures. Cultures obtained according to the instant methodology are also featured as are methods of identifying adipogenic modulatory agents, e.g., high-throughput screening assays.
Abstract: Methods of identifying insulin response modulators are provided. Therapeutic methods utilizing compounds identified according to the methods of the invention are also provided. In particular, methods of treating diabetes and insulin resistance are provided.
Abstract: The present invention pertains to compounds effective at modulating fatty acid or triglyceride (“fat”) accumulation by cells, such compounds having therapeutic potential as regulators of body mass and for the treatment of overweight individuals, obesity, and metabolic disorders. Featured compounds are set forth and exemplified herein. Therapeutic methods and pharmaceutical compositions featuring these compounds are also provided.
